Built on decades of global apparel expertise.
All is Well is powered by Classic Fashion.
Founded in Jordan in 2003, Classic Fashion combines large scale production,
advanced textile innovation, and globally trusted manufacturing systems.

Advanced manufacturing ecosystem
Classic Fashion continues to invest in advanced manufacturing technologies designed to improve consistency, precision, and production quality at scale. Hundreds of production lines are digitally connected through real time production and quality tracking systems, helping monitor operations across the manufacturing ecosystem.
The production infrastructure also includes embroidery, printing, garment laundry, laser technologies, and advanced finishing capabilities supporting large scale apparel manufacturing. These systems allow tighter control over garment quality, production consistency, and long term product durability.

Textile innovation & quality
Classic Fashion’s vertically integrated structure extends into textile manufacturing through BIA Textiles, supporting fabric development, knitting, processing, and scalable textile production. The ecosystem is designed to support performance focused apparel development with greater control over materials and production quality.
To support quality assurance, Classic Fashion operates accredited laboratory facilities recognized by global apparel organizations and brands. These systems help ensure consistency across durability, fabric performance, color standards, and garment quality.

Classic Fashion continues to invest in renewable energy, water recycling, circular manufacturing systems, and responsible production technologies designed to reduce long term environmental impact.


Its sustainability infrastructure includes solar energy projects, Zero Liquid Discharge systems, circular waste initiatives, and internationally aligned chemical management standards.
5.5 MWh Solar Farm
An award winning 5.5 MWh solar farm in Mafraq supports long term renewable energy transition initiatives across manufacturing operations.
Water Recycling Systems
Sewage and effluent treatment systems, including Zero Liquid Discharge infrastructure, recycle water across manufacturing and laundry operations.
Circular Manufacturing
Fabric waste and recycled materials are repurposed through circular manufacturing initiatives supporting fiber recovery, recycling, and waste reduction processes.
ZDHC & Higg FEM Standards
Manufacturing processes follow internationally recognized sustainability and chemical management standards including ZDHC and Higg FEM.
